Structural foundation repair services address issues related to the stability and integrity of a building’s foundation. These services typically involve assessing the current condition of the foundation and implementing solutions to correct problems such as settling, cracking, or shifting. Repair methods may include underpinning, piering, or installing new supports to stabilize the structure and prevent further damage. The goal is to restore the foundation’s strength and ensure the safety and durability of the property.
Foundation problems often manifest through vis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, or doors and windows that no longer close properly. These issues can be caused by soil movement, moisture changes, or poor initial construction. Structural foundation repair services help resolve these concerns by addressing the root causes of foundation movement and reinforcing the affected areas. Proper repair can prevent more severe structural damage and mitigate safety risks associated with compromised foundations.

The overview below groups typical Structural Foundation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in De Soto, KS.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Foundation Repair Costs - Typical expenses for foundation repairs can range from $2,000 to $7,500, depending on the extent of damage and repair methods used. Smaller repairs, such as pier and beam stabilization, may cost around $1,500, while major underpinning projects can exceed $10,000.
Labor and Material Expenses - Labor costs generally account for a significant portion of the total, often between 50% and 70%. Material costs vary based on the repair type, with concrete piers costing approximately $1,000 to $3,000 per set, depending on size and number.
Factors Affecting Costs - The complexity of the foundation issue, accessibility, and soil conditions influence overall costs. For example, repairs in areas with expansive clay soils may require additional stabilization measures, increasing expenses.
Cost Variability - Prices for foundation repair services can vary widely across different local providers, with typical ranges from $2,500 to $10,000. Contacting local pros can help determine specific costs based on individual project need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of foundation problems? Indicators include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ping floors, doors or windows that stick or don’t close properly, and gaps around window frames or exterior walls.
How do professionals typically repair foundation issues? Repair methods vary but often involve underpinning, piering, or slab stabilization to restore stability and prevent further damage.
Is foundation repair necessary for minor cracks? Not all cracks require repair; however, significant or growing cracks should be evaluated by a professional to determine if repair is needed.
What factors contribute to foundation settlement or shifting? Factors include soil type and moisture changes, poor drainage, tree roots, and construction or landscaping activities nearby.
